Transaction 2cab3ad8f8448f3efe8db322bc34271c27f7739bf438b94d8eb178f8bbaceaa4
1 Input
1 Output
-
2cab3ad8f8448f3efe8db322bc34271c27f7739bf438b94d8eb178f8bbaceaa4:0
- value
- 17918167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72d629d0f79050c25733de793ec56c1d70c3370c OP_EQUAL
- address
- 3CADWk1zT4ehLAqcu9QY8mtmdDSJKh2FU8